The gas furnace is the heating element of the Heating & Air Conditioning (Heating, Ventilation, & Air Conditioning) plan in a home. It provides warmth while all of us were in cold weather by circulating heated air throughout the house via ductwork. The gas furnace itself is usually located in the basement or garage. There are several types of gas furnace, but they all work on the same principle, gas & oil gas heating systems burn fuel to create heat, while electric gas heating systems use electricity to generate heat. Some gas heating systems also have a built-in heat pump, which can be used for both heating & cooling. Smart control units can be connected to gas furnace systems to help regulate temperature & improve energy efficiency. In the summer, the gas furnace is not used for heating, but the blower motor still circulates cooled air from the AC unit through the house… Regular repair & cleaning of the gas furnace will help extend its lifespan & ensure it runs efficiently.
